The NFL continues today, with another slew of Sunday games. The sixth Sunday of the 2016 regular season. Football!
The Tampa Bay Buccaneers have their bye week, but there’s plenty to watch for Bucs fans. Obviously, the Carolina Panthers playing the New Orleans Saints is worth watching, even if they may only be deciding who gets to be in last place in the NFC South.
The San Francisco 49ers play the Buffalo Bills, before playing the Bucs next week. Colin Kaepernick will be starting for the first time this year, so this’ll be a good preview of what the Bucs should expect next Sunday.
There’s also the game between the Atlanta Falcons and Seattle Seahawks. The Bucs need the Falcons to start losing games, so Tampa Bay can get back into the NFC South race. The Bucs also face the Seahawks later this week, so that’d be a pretty good preview, too.
